17.2.2 Particle size, shape, and distribution Particle size is usually measured by screening – by passing the metal powder through sieves of various mesh sizes. 9 Screen analysis is achieved by using a vertical stack of screens with the mesh size becoming fine as the powder flows downward through the screens. particle size needs to include assessment of improve-ments in feed efficiency versus reductions in milling production. These and other data suggest a dietary particle size of approximately 700 microns to optimize both pig performance and milling efficiency. 01.04.1995Reducing particle size increased electrical energy required for milling and decreased milling production rates, especially as particle size was decreased from 600 to 400 /μm. Reducing particle size of the from 1,000 to 400 μ mincreased gain/feed by 8% (linear effect, P .001) and digestibility of GE by 7% (quadratic effect, P .03).

Particle size distribution can greatly affect the efficiency of any collection device. Settling chambers will normally only collect very large particles, those that can be separated using sieve trays. Centrifugal collectors will normally collect particles down to about 20 μm.
